The Order-to-Cash (O2C) Process & Benefits for Working Capital
The order-to-cash (O2C) process encompasses all steps from receiving a customer order to collecting payment and reconciling cash. It includes order management, invoicing, credit management, collections, cash application, and reporting. Efficient O2C processes directly impact working capital, liquidity, and overall business performance.
By integrating predictive cash forecasting into O2C, organizations gain visibility into potential cash inflows and outflows. This allows for more accurate planning of supplier payments, debt obligations, and capital investments. Improved cash flow visibility reduces reliance on short-term financing and enhances operational resilience.
Traditional vs AI-Driven Cash Forecasting Methods
Traditional cash forecasting relies heavily on spreadsheets, historical averages, and manual adjustments. These methods are prone to errors, slow to update, and do not account for real-time variables such as customer payment delays or economic changes.
AI-driven forecasting, on the other hand, applies machine learning algorithms to historical and current data. These models continuously learn from new data, adjust predictions dynamically, and identify patterns invisible to humans. By automating repetitive tasks like data aggregation and reconciliation, AI frees up finance teams to focus on strategic decision-making.
Key Metrics in O2C: DSO, Unapplied Cash, Dispute Analytics and Accuracy Targets
Several key metrics determine the health and efficiency of the O2C cycle:
- Days Sales Outstanding (DSO) – Measures the average collection period for receivables.
- Unapplied Cash – Cash received but not yet matched to invoices, which can distort liquidity visibility.
- Dispute Analytics – Tracks disputed invoices to prevent revenue leakage and delays in cash collection.
- Forecast Accuracy – Measures the deviation between predicted and actual cash inflows, essential for financial planning.
AI-powered predictive cash forecasting enhances these metrics by providing insights into payment behavior, automating cash application, and improving collections efficiency. Organizations adopting AI in O2C achieve higher forecast precision and operational agility.

Machine Learning Models Powering Predictive Cash Forecasting
AI-driven cash forecasting relies on machine learning models to analyze historical financial data, customer payment patterns, and operational trends. These models identify correlations and predict future cash inflows with a high degree of accuracy. By continuously learning from new data, machine learning ensures forecasts evolve in real time, adapting to changing market and business conditions.
Common algorithms include regression analysis, time-series forecasting, and ensemble methods, each designed to improve the precision of cash predictions. These models also allow finance teams to perform “what-if” analyses, simulating scenarios like delayed customer payments, unexpected expenses, or sudden order surges.

Implementing AI in Cash Forecasting: Step-by-Step O2C Modernization
Step 1: Credit Assessment and Risk Evaluation
AI begins the predictive cash forecasting process by assessing credit risk. By analyzing historical payment patterns, financial statements, and market trends, AI-powered tools assign a risk score to each customer. This allows organizations to anticipate potential delays in payment and proactively adjust credit limits or payment terms.
Machine learning models can detect subtle patterns in customer behavior, such as late payments during specific months or recurring partial payments, enabling finance teams to make informed credit decisions.
Step 2: Invoice Processing and Automated Matching
Automated invoice processing accelerates the O2C cycle. AI systems can extract invoice data, validate it against purchase orders, and match it with customer accounts in real time. Intelligent invoice matching reduces manual effort, minimizes errors, and ensures that receivables data is accurate for cash flow forecasting.
This automation also enables early detection of discrepancies or disputes, which can impact forecast accuracy if left unresolved.
Step 3: Cash Application and Payment Allocation
AI-driven cash application automates the allocation of incoming payments to the correct invoices, even in high-volume environments. Advanced algorithms handle complex remittance data, including partial payments, deductions, and adjustments.
By eliminating manual intervention, organizations can reduce unapplied cash, improve DSO, and maintain accurate cash forecasts. AI can also learn from past allocations to handle exceptions more efficiently over time.
Step 4: Collections Optimization
AI improves collections strategies by prioritizing customers based on payment likelihood, outstanding balances, and risk scores. Predictive analytics identifies which customers require proactive engagement, helping finance teams focus efforts where they are most effective.
Automated reminders, escalation workflows, and personalized communication strategies ensure timely collections, reduce late payments, and enhance cash flow predictability.
Step 5: Dispute Management and Resolution
Payment disputes can significantly impact forecast accuracy. AI-powered dispute management tools identify patterns, categorize disputes, and suggest resolution strategies. By automating dispute tracking and resolution, organizations can reduce the time receivables are tied up and improve liquidity.
AI also helps finance teams analyze root causes of recurring disputes, enabling process improvements that prevent future issues.
Step 6: Forecasting and Scenario Planning
Once data from credit assessment, invoice processing, cash application, collections, and disputes is consolidated, AI generates predictive cash forecasts. Scenario planning allows organizations to simulate outcomes under different conditions, such as changes in customer behavior, market fluctuations, or operational disruptions.
This capability supports strategic decision-making, ensuring that finance teams can prepare for uncertainties while optimizing working capital.
Step 7: Continuous Monitoring and Feedback Loops
AI models continuously learn from new data, improving forecast accuracy over time. Real-time monitoring of KPIs such as DSO, unapplied cash, and dispute resolution status ensures that forecasts remain reliable.
Feedback loops enable the system to adapt to changes in payment patterns or business conditions, ensuring the O2C process is both resilient and agile.

Anomaly Detection for Risk Mitigation
AI-powered anomaly detection identifies irregularities in payment patterns, collections, or invoice data that could indicate errors, fraud, or emerging credit risks. By flagging anomalies in real-time, organizations can take immediate corrective actions to prevent negative impacts on cash flow forecasts.
For example, sudden changes in customer payment behavior or unexpected deductions can be detected and investigated before they distort cash forecasts.

Key KPIs to Track for AI Cash Forecasting
Measuring the success of AI-driven cash forecasting requires monitoring specific KPIs, including:
- Forecast Accuracy: Compare predicted cash inflows against actuals.
- DSO Reduction: Track improvements in days sales outstanding.
- Cash Flow Variance: Monitor deviations between forecasted and actual cash flow.
- Collections Efficiency: Measure speed and success rate of receivables collections.
- Working Capital Optimization: Assess improvements in liquidity and capital allocation.
